Service Template CSV exports using semicolons (;) instead of commas (,)

When exporting a configuration from a service template, the resulting CSV has semicolons instead of commas to separate columns. Also to note, when importing the same CSV it will fail because the columns are not comma-separated.

In Cube settings under "Regional", I have tried setting the CSV separator set to "comma" as well as "Windows culture" (I am in the US, where the Windows default is comma), but it still exports with a semicolon.

To note, when exporting elements to CSV, it will follow the CSV separator selected here. The issue only occurs with service template configurations.

Is this a bug? Or can this setting be modified somewhere else?

Hi Nick, I tested this locally on a v10.4 CU10 and v10.5.1 and I can verify the behavior you see.

My regional settings are also defined using a comma, but the CSV is still exported using semi-colons. Even when configuring it via Cube settings, it remains unchanged.

You will have noticed it in your mails already, but I took the liberty to create a task for this and have already sent it to our SW team: Exporting service template CSV not in configured format | Collaboration
